JOB SUMMARY
Under the administrative supervision of the Marketing and Communication Director, the Research Advisor coordinates all research activities for Marie Stopes International Ethiopia’s core business and projects and facilitates for an informed decision through providing qualitative and quantitative data that has a cross cutting nature. The Advisor works closely with MIS, Grants, Service Outlets, Departments and MSI International Team.
DUTES/TASKS
Managing research activities
· Designs quantitative and qualitative research studies in line with MSI Ethiopia’s programme information needs;
· Develops well budgeted and realistic research component for MSI Ethiopia’s concept notes and grant proposals;
· Monitors Research budget;
· Prepares data collection tools and train field data collectors, and monitor implementation of field research activities.
· Manages and supervises all consultants contracted to conduct research on behalf of MSI Ethiopia;
· Ensures data collected is entered using appropriate software packages, cleaned and analysed;
· Prepares bidding documents for research activities;
· Undertakes research activities and undertakes baseline surveys in the areas of new program intervention;
· Keeps relevant staff members abreast of new research by other organisations with relevance for MSI Ethiopia’s work.
· Prepares research findings for presentation at national and international conferences and for submission to peer reviewed journals and other publications.
Liaises with external research collaborators (e.g. WHO, USAID etc.) on specific research protocols conducted in partnership with MSI Ethiopia.
Coordination for donor-funded projects
Works with Grant Team to ensure that up-to-date Research Plans are in place for all donor-funded projects.
Designs output indicators and manage research for all donor funded programs;
Ensures all provider and client communications materials are pre-tested as per the any global standard tools and frameworks;
Support in bringing organizational excellence through conducting pertinent researches;
Provides the researched inputs during the development and review of MSI Ethiopia’s strategic plan, and annual business plans;
Provides technical inputs on research during the development of project proposals;
Proactively engage with SLT to flag or disseminate changes in service delivery trends following regular programme monitoring and data analysis;
Work in close coordination with MIS Manager and other departments.
Liaises proactively with Marie Stopes International Regional Research Office;
Performs related tasks as required
